Portál AbcLinuxu, 6. května 2025 20:40

Dotaz: Ztráta zvuku

20.8.2012 17:01 p0o9I
Ztráta zvuku
Přečteno: 526×
Odpovědět | Admin
Dobrý den, něco se mi stalo se zvukem a přestal fungovat. Bohužel nevím kdy a při čem. mám Kubuntu 12.04 x64, Kmix hlásí "Prázdný výstup", nejde nastavit žádná karta, stejně tak nic nevidí Phonon ani Pavucontrol. Alsamixer karty vidí (všechny tři), podle lspci -k tam také všechny jsou a dokonce mají správné ovladače (připadají mi povědomé podle toho co jsem vídal a distributor sedí.).

při cat /proc/asound/cards vypíše zase všechny tři. aplay se zdá, že funguje, ale není slyšet

Z windows zvuk funguje (resp. nezkoušel jsem všechny tři, zajímá mě jen jedna karta, ta funguje)

Řešení dotazu:


Nástroje: Začni sledovat (0)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

Migi avatar 20.8.2012 17:35 Migi | skóre: 59 | blog: Mig_Alley
Rozbalit Rozbalit vše Re: Ztráta zvuku
Odpovědět | | Sbalit | Link | Blokovat | Admin
neni zvuk v alsamixeru zeslabeny?
20.8.2012 17:43 p0o9I
Rozbalit Rozbalit vše Re: Ztráta zvuku
Bohužel není teď jsem zkusil ještě odinstalovat pulseaudio -> po restartu alespoň nějaký pokrok Kmix vidí zvukovky, že by se daly použít to je jiná věc, zkusím znovu nainstalovat, jestli se to prostě nechytne.
20.8.2012 17:46 p0o9I
Rozbalit Rozbalit vše Re: Ztráta zvuku
Ne, to nepomohlo, jsem zase tam, kde jsem začal
21.8.2012 09:54 Pindal
Rozbalit Rozbalit vše Re: Ztráta zvuku
Kupodivu. Tohle by ti fungovalo maximálně ve Windows. Zkus "alsamixer -c0" a šoupej.
21.8.2012 11:30 dustin | skóre: 63 | blog: dustin
Rozbalit Rozbalit vše Re: Ztráta zvuku
Když ti to zrovna nebude fungovat, spusť a zkopíruj sem výstupy příkazů:

Výpis zvukovkek:

aplay -l

Výpis všech nastavení první (defaultní) zvukovky:

amixer contents

Výpis procesů, které mají zrova otevřená zvuková zařízení. Nejčastějším důvodem "nezvučení" bývá to, že jiný proces obsadil tvou zvukovku (typicky mixer), zatímco tvůj přehrávací program chce přistupovat ke zvukovce napřímo (tedy ne přes pulseaudio) a ty o tom nevíš.

sudo lsof /dev/snd/*

21.8.2012 12:39 p0o9I
Rozbalit Rozbalit vše Re: Ztráta zvuku
Příloha:
alsamixery ztlumené nejsou, alespoň se tak tváří..

Výpisy jsem raději dal do přiloženého txt protože mi přišly dlouhé, než abych je vypisoval sem.

sudo lsof /dev/snd/* nic nevrací
21.8.2012 16:47 dustin | skóre: 63 | blog: dustin
Rozbalit Rozbalit vše Re: Ztráta zvuku
OK, takže card 0 je integrovaná zvukovka na desce, card 1 Xonar a card 2 zvukovka v grafice pro HDMI. Do které z nich máš připojené repráky, kterou máš jako defaultní (obvykle card 0)?
21.8.2012 17:28 p0o9I
Rozbalit Rozbalit vše Re: Ztráta zvuku
Ano, je to tak. Repro mám zapojené do card1, tedy Xonar. Defaultní zvukovka - myslel jsem, že default je vždy card0, jestli ne tak to asi neumím zjistit, natož nastavit. (Zkusím ještě pogooglit)
21.8.2012 18:24 dustin | skóre: 63 | blog: dustin
Rozbalit Rozbalit vše Re: Ztráta zvuku
OK. Takže default jsi neměnil (tedy card0, integrovaná na desce), zvuk chceš do card 1, nehraje to. Pulseaudio říkáš, že máš odinstalované.

Aplikace, které používají rovnou alsu, mají nastavený output na default - tedy card 0. Aplikace, které používají pulseaudio, fungovat nebudou, protože pulseaudio nemáš.

Jaký máš nastavený backend ve phononu? KDE nepoužívám, takže nevím, kde to najít. Pokud pulseaudio, je potřeba přehodit na něco jiného (gstreamer, xine,... nevím) a to je potřeba nastavit na card1.

IMO nejsnazší by bylo použít pulseaudio, všechny aplikace přehodit na něj a v něm si vybrat Xonar.

Nebo pokud jsi "audiophile" (xonar je dost drahá zvukovka), pro dobrý pocit odstraň pulseaudio a vše předělej na alsu (nicméně nevěřím, že to bude mít vliv na zvuk). Ale budeš si muset aplikace překonfigurovat zřejmě ručně na alsu a pak v .asoundrc nastavit jako default card 1.
21.8.2012 18:53 p0o9I
Rozbalit Rozbalit vše Re: Ztráta zvuku

Pulseaudio jsem odinstaloval jen na chvíli a doufal jsem v magickou autokonfiguraci při jeho opětovné instalaci. Teď už tam zase je.

Přišlo mi, že ani bez pulseaudia to nefungovalo. Kmix sice viděl karty ale nějak nefungovalo nic, testování výstupu (přes Phonon) systémová hlášení a dokonce
aplay fungoval jinak tak nějak vypadal že spíš nefunguje..

Backend, hmm mám cz verzi, je to to samé jako implementace? tam je pouze Gstreamer. Ve vliv pulseaudia na zvuk taky nevěřím, i když o tom nic nevím.. Když už jsme u toho obecně mi přijde že pod Linuxem mám lepší zvuk než pod win..

.asoundcr jsem nějak nenašel

Řešení 1× (p0o9I (tazatel))
22.8.2012 18:10 p0o9I
Rozbalit Rozbalit vše Re: Ztráta zvuku
Tak jsem to vyřešil, reinstaloval jsem celý systém. Sice tak vznikl jiný problém, ketrý jsem před tím neměl, ale to se dořeší postupně..

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.